IMPORTANT

If you store or move your refrigerator in freezing temperatures, be sure to completely drain the water supply

system. Failure to do so could result in water leaks when the refrigerator is put back into service. Contact a service

representative to perform this operation.

CAUTION

• Pull the refrigerator straight out to move it. Shifting it from side to side may damage flooring. Be careful not to

move the refrigerator beyond the plumbing connections.

• Damp objects stick to cold metal surfaces. Do not touch refrigerated surfaces with wet or damp hands.

NOTE

Do not use abrasive cleaners such as window sprays, scouring cleansers, flammable fluids, cleaning waxes,

concentrated detergents, bleaches, or cleansers containing petroleum products on plastic parts, interior doors,

gaskets, or cabinet liners. Do not use paper towels, scouring pads, or other abrasive cleaning materials.

NOTE

If you set your temperature controls to turn off cooling, power to lights and other electrical components will continue

until you unplug the power cord from the wall outlet.

CARE & CLEANING

Protecting your investment

Keeping your refrigerator clean maintains its appearance and prevents odor build-up. Wipe up any spills immediately

and clean the freezer and fresh food compartments at least twice a year.

• Remove adhesive labels by hand. Do not use razor blades or other sharp instruments which can scratch the

appliance surface.

• Do not remove the serial plate. Removal of your serial plate voids your warranty.
• Before moving your refrigerator, raise the anti-tip brackets so the rollers will work correctly. This will prevent the

floor from being damaged.

Refer to the guide on the next page for details on caring and cleaning specific areas of your refrigerator.

• Never use metallic scouring pads, brushes, abrasive cleaners, or strong alkaline solutions on any surface.
• Never use CHLORIDE or cleaners with bleach to clean stainless steel.
• Do not wash any removable parts in a dishwasher.
• Always unplug the electrical power cord from the wall outlet before cleaning.
